Grilled Pork Chops With Peach Parsley Salad Recipe

Serve the chops with peppery arugula and stone fruit salad, a perfect savory-sweet dinner pairing. Peaches and apricots are called for here, but any in-season stone fruit like plums or nectarines would taste great alongside. Also, bone-in, center-cut pork chops are the way to go here because anything smaller will cook much more quickly.

How To Clean Laminate Wood Floors The Right Way

Laminate wood flooring is made from layers of composite wood pressed together and sealed with laminate. Laminate wood looks like solid wood, but it can be a better choice in many ways: It is more durable, less susceptible to scratches (which can be a major issue if you have pets), and more moisture resistant. Choosing to install laminate wood flooring can also help homeowners save money. It gives you the look of a wood floor at a much lower price point....

How To Raise Open Minded Eaters With Tips From A Registered Dietitan

When food and mealtime become a point of stress, kids pick up on that and may push back against any form of pressure. In fact, studies have shown that higher levels of picky eating are associated with increased restrictions and more demands from parents, even if the intention of the parents is to encourage their children to eat more nutritious foods. While it might be hard, the most effective solutions are to be patient through these phases, and to continue to offer your child a variety of foods....
